Ingredients and spices that need to be Make ready to make Hyderabadi style chicken curry:

  1. 500 grms Chicken pieces
  2. 1 Onion paste
  3. 2 Big sized Sliced onion
  4. 1/2 tsp Turmeric powder
  5. 4-5 Whole red chilli
  6. 1 tsp Kashmiri red chilli powder
  7. 2 tbsp Coriander seeds
  8. 1 tsp Cumin seeds
  9. 1/2 tsp Garam masala
  10. 2 to 3 Cloves
  11. 1 inch stick Cinnamon
  12. 1 Green cardamom
  13. 1 tbsp Ginger garlic paste
  14. 2 tbsp Curd
  15. As per taste Salt
  16. 1/2 cup Oil

Steps to make to make Hyderabadi style chicken curry

  1. Heat oil in a pan.
    Add sliced onion and deep fry the onion and strain it.
  2. Dry roast the coriander seeds, cumin seeds, whole red chilli, cinnamon stick, cloves and cardamom, once cooled to make a powder.
  3. Marinate chicken with curd,ginger garlic, salt, fried onion paste, red chilli powder and kashmiri mirch powder.
  4. Keep aside for 4 - 5 hours.
    Heat oil in a pan add onion paste and saute for 4 - 5 mins now add marinated chicken pieces and turmeric powder and cook in a medium flame until oil leaves the pan.
  5. Add half cup of water and bring to boil,once boiled keep it in a low flame and cook for five mins.
  6. Serve hot with chapati or rice.
